P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Eure Meinung zur Assemblersektion...



rob00n
03.09.2007, 16:31
Wie findet ihr die Sektion.
Wer kann Assembler?
Für was benutzt ihr es?

Lassts krachen und postet! ^^

Nemo.A
03.09.2007, 17:06
Ich (Der Moderator dieser Sektion *sich groß fühlt* hehe :P ), programmiere natürlich in Assembler.
Habe bisher einen großen Nutzen daraus gezogen. Wenn man seine Programmierkentnisse (und nicht nur das; Sondern auch das tiefere Wissen über den PC) steigern möchte, trifft man ob früh oder spät, auf Assembler.
Hat man hier erstmal die Grundkenntnisse drauf, dann gehts ab. Da stehen einem viele Türen offen, die wirklich sehr sehr interessant sind:
-Buffer Overflows / Format Strings
-Das Programmieren von Cryptern/Bindern usw.
-Viel wissen über Ausführbare Dateien (z.B. deren Aufbau usw.)
-Reverse Engineering (Cracken von Software; Algorithmen herausfinden usw.)
-Gamehacking (Trainer erstellen, Memory editieren)
-Viren/Würmer
und noch einiges mehr.
Ihr seht, es gibt wirklich sehr viele Bereiche dass Assembler abdeckt. Ich habe hier mal als Thema nur Hacking/Security genommen. Und es gibt noch weit mehr Themen außerhalb dieser Grenze (z.B. Betriebssystem Programmierung, um mal was großes zu nennen).

Ich selbst benutze es für Buffer Overflows, Gamehacking und Reverse Engineering (Macht alles wirklich Spaß, solltet ihr euch auch mal mit beschäftigen :) )

Sens0r
03.09.2007, 21:05
Hallo,

ich kann Motorolla Assembler, damit hab ich unter anderm Microcontroller programmiert. Assembler ist sicherlich sehr interessant, aus den Gründen die Nemo bereits erläutert hat, aber auch sehr nervenzerreisend.
Ich habe in vielen Programmiersprache Erfarung, da ich fast täglich irgendwas programmiere, jedoch, oder gerade deswegen viel mir das Assembler lernen schwerer, da verliert man wirklich alles an Komfort, so hat man, wenns gut geht 2 Akkumulators die man laden kann, sowas ist für jemanden der täglich java programmiert relativ unvorstellbar. In der Tat bei Assembler sind die Denkwege bei Assembler definitiv anders gestrickt als bei modernen Sprachen.

Weiterhin muss ich sagen das ASM einem sehr viel über die Speicherverwaltung lehrt, und man es schon alleine deswegen beherrschen können müsste ;)

mfg
Sens0r

]=-antr4xx-=[
04.09.2007, 12:53
Ich finde es gut, dass diese Sektion erstellt wurde. Ich hatte sie ja vorgeschlagen, und übrigens den Nemo auch als Moderator;).
Ich finde Nemo's Liste von realisierbaren Sachen sehr interessant. Ich selbst habe vor ca. einer Woche angefangen, und auch wenn sich mein Wissen aufs minimalste beschränkt, merke ich jetzt schon, wie weit mich diese Sprache bringen kann. Ich werde wahrscheinlich des Öfteren hier anzutreffen sein...;)

l33cher
04.09.2007, 16:24
Auch ich war ja für die sektion, deshalb freu ich mich natürlich dass sie da ist !
Hab assembler auch erst vor kurzem angefangen und bin echt begeristert davon. Auch wenn ich natürlich den Komfort einer Hochsprache vermisse, finde ich es trotzdem (bis jetzt noch) viel interessanter als diese, und hab solangsam das gefühl zu verstehen wie der pc funktioniert :)
Werde mich noch weiter mit den grundlagen rumschlagen, melde mich dann später erst wenn ich an meinem ersten projekt (hab schon ne idee) sitze und nicht weiterkomm^^

xman06
04.09.2007, 17:22
Also ich hab bis jetzt noch nicht viel mit Assembler zu tun gehabt, ab und zu mal ein bisschen mit dem Disassembler rumgespielt aber eigentlich nicht wirklich viel Ahnung von der Programmiersprache wenn man es als solche bezeichnen möchte. Ich bin auf jeden Fall gespannt was sich hier noch so tut und schaue auf jeden Fall mal regelmäßig vorbei!

born2die
04.09.2007, 19:35
Hey ho,
ich bin auch gerade am ASM lernen versteh inzwischen schon einiges hab mir jetzt auch ein Buch zugelegt wo echt alles mit Grafik und so beschreiben wird das werde ich mir jetzt mal reinziehen ^^. Ich selber nutze Asm für Gamehacking (was ich halt bisher kann...) und Reversing (verstehen tu ichs ja schon ^^") ansonsten werd ich mal ein paar Asm tuts hochladen mit Sources und dann posten...

born2die

Steiger_mp
05.09.2007, 16:50
joa hat mich überrascht das es eine ASM section gibt..ja asm mein sorgenkind.. wie meine vorgänger cshon gsaten ..man muss hier ein programm anders aufbaun als sonst wo..und die fehlersuche ist imer nervenzereibend^^ aber trotzdem lern ich weiter asm^^

n00kie
19.09.2007, 21:15
Also ich freue mich sehr über die Assembler Section, dah ich gerade Assembler am lernen bin. Aber wie gesagt alles sehr nervenzereibend.

Cod33r
31.10.2007, 22:00
Ich bin auch überfroh das es eine Assembler Sektion
gibt. Ich hatte vor kurzem die Grundkenntnisse gelernt
und herausgefunden welche Mittel man hat wenn man
diese Sprache kann. Ich bin wirklich froh darüber eine
eigene Sektion zu haben in der man sich weiterbilden kann.

mfg Cod33r

l0dsb
01.11.2007, 14:04
Nutze Assembler hauptsächlich für's Reverse Engineering und zum Coden. Auch wenn ich meistens in C++ schreibe, gibt es doch manchmal Projekte, die man in Assembler gut realisieren kann, ansonsten eben per Inline-Assembler. :>